Stat. § 590.11","heading":"Recreational fires.","body":"(1) It is unlawful for any individual or group of individuals to build a warming fire, bonfire, or campfire and leave it unattended while visible flame, smoke, or emissions exist.\n(2) Anyone who violates this section commits a misdemeanor of the second degree, punishable as provided in s. 775.082 or s. 775.083.\nHistory.—s. 12, ch. 17029, 1935; CGL 1936 Supp. 4151(10-qq); s. 8, ch. 99-292; s. 40, ch. 2002-295; s. 24, ch. 2013-226.","path":["CHAPTER 590 FOREST PROTECTION"],"source_url":"https://www.leg.state.fl.us/statutes/index.cfm?App_mode=Display_Statute\u0026URL=0500-0599/0590/0590.html","current_through":"2026 Florida Statutes","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-08-27T02:09:57Z","sha256":"8a2b6efcc1c92425da6c9359fe976ed4098f98b800233ea12dc5b388b9bef04c","source_id":"us-fl","stale":false,"prev":"us-fl/fla.-stat.-590.10","next":"us-fl/fla.-stat.-590.125"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
